Behaviour Assessment
Description
This is a flexible course that is offered in-person and online at the same time. This course introduces students to assessment methods for identifying skills strengths and deficits; and the occurrence of problem behaviour in the field of Applied Behaviour Analysis (Aba). Behaviour Assessment conducted prior to the development of an intervention plan is essential for optimum outcomes and as well follows ethical guidelines and best practice. Students will develop skills associated with selecting, conducting and understanding assessment methods and their results.
